Abstract :
The traditional spatio-temporal database stores the quantitative data such as coordinate. But the qualitative information is more close to human thought and requires less storage space and process time. The previous qualitative spatio-temporal systems were all prototype systems which did not support general spatio-temporal relation model and data input. We design the qualitative spatio-temporal database (QSTDB) based on spatio-temporal reasoning. A general spatio-temporal relation framework is put forward and applied to QSTDB. GML data can be converted to QSTDB as input. Thus QSTDB is compatible to most current spatio-temporal relation models and spatio-temporal systems. QSTDB can be applied to qualitative spatio-temporal query, spatio-temporal ontologies, spatio-temporal data mining and way finding systems etc
